Our Board

Peaks & Plains Housing Trust is governed by a Board. The Board set the overall direction for the Trust, make sure the Trust is run effectively, and make sure the Trust achieves long term success.

Our Board is responsible for:

  • setting the Trust's overall strategy and objectives
  • defining the Trust’s values 
  • making sure that the risks faced by the Trust are effectively managed
  • having effective oversight of the delivery of services – including financial and other performance
  • making sure that the Trust’s affairs are carried out lawfully and in line with regulatory requirements

The Board is supported by two committees, the Audit Committee and the Governance Committee.
